MANILA, Philippines — A magnitude 5.1 earthquake shook the province of Surigao del Sur on Sunday afternoon, according to the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ology (Phivolcs).
Phivolcs said the tremor occurred at 3:29 p.m. some 84 kilometers (kms) northeast of Bayabas town.

Tectonic in origin, the quake had a depth of 22 kms, the seismology bureau said.
